
When the red water temperature light illuminates in a sedan, it indicates that the water temperature is too high. Below is relevant information about the car's water temperature light: 1. Definition: The water temperature indicator is a bimetallic strip sensor switch screwed into the engine block water jacket, which controls the red indicator light (high-temperature warning light) on the instrument panel. 2. Explanation of the Water Temperature Indicator: This indicator displays the temperature of the coolant inside the engine. When the ignition is turned on and the vehicle performs a self-check, the light will illuminate for a few seconds and then turn off. If the water temperature light remains on, it means the coolant temperature has exceeded the specified limit, and driving should be stopped immediately. The light will turn off once the water temperature returns to normal.

















As an experienced driver who has been behind the wheel for many years, I can tell you that a red coolant temperature warning light is no small matter. The most common cause is insufficient coolant, often due to a leaking radiator or rapid evaporation, especially during long summer trips when thermal expansion can cause it to spray out. If the cooling fan gets stuck or stops working, the engine heat can't dissipate, triggering the warning light. A faulty water pump disrupts normal coolant circulation, causing temperatures to spike. An aging thermostat might get stuck in the closed position, blocking coolant flow to the radiator. Even faulty sensors can cause false alarms. Let me warn you - this directly impacts engine longevity and can lead to cylinder scoring or piston damage. If the red light comes on, immediately pull over, shut off the engine, and wait for it to cool before checking the coolant reservoir level. In emergencies, you can top it up with distilled water, but this isn't recommended long-term. It's best to visit a repair shop for diagnostic testing.
